Study Summary

The goal of this study is to learn more about omega-3 polyunsaturated fatty acids supplementation on blood lipid profile and platelets in patients with high cholesterol levels. The purpose of this research is to gather information on the safety and effect of two different fish oils, eicosapentaenoic acid (EPA) and docosahexaenoic acid (DHA). Participants will: Visit the clinic 3 times during study checkups, tests and blood collection. Randomized to either the EPA or the DHA supplementation group. Be given a 28-day food and activity log.

Primary Outcome

Platelet aggregation will be assessed as the primary endpoint. The percentage of platelet aggregation will be measured at multiple time points, and the area under the curve (AUC) will be calculated to serve as a comprehensive marker of platelet aggregation response. Data will be presented as mean ± standard deviation or other appropriate statistical summaries.
